内容主体大纲 1. 引言 - 什么是加密货币? - 加密货币钱包的作用 2. 加密货币钱包类型 - 热钱包和冷钱包的区别 - 移动...
随着数字经济的快速发展,加密货币作为一种新兴的金融工具逐渐走入人们的视野。从比特币的诞生开始,加密货币以其去中心化、匿名性和全球化的特性吸引了无数投资者与用户。然而,伴随而来的是各种安全问题,如何确保交易的安全性和隐私性成为了亟待解决的课题。
在这一背景下,非对称加密技术的应用显得尤为重要。非对称加密,不同于传统的对称加密,其采用一对密钥(公钥和私钥)来实现信息的安全传输,极大地提升了加密货币的安全性。本文将深入探讨非对称加密在加密货币中的应用及其带来的安全性提升。
### 非对称加密的基本原理 #### 概述对称加密与非对称加密在了解非对称加密之前,我们首先需要明白对称加密的概念。在对称加密中,发送方和接收方使用同一个密钥进行加密和解密。然而,这种模式存在一个明显的缺陷:密钥的传输。如果密钥在传输过程中被截获,黑客将轻松获得敏感信息。
与此相对,非对称加密利用了一对密钥:公钥和私钥。公钥可公开,任何人都可以使用它加密信息,但只有持有对应私钥的人才能解密。这样,即使公钥被截获,黑客也无法解密信息。
#### 非对称加密的工作机制非对称加密通常基于数学难题,如大数分解或椭圆曲线问题。以下是其基本步骤:
1. 生成公私密钥对。 2. 发送方用接收方的公钥加密信息。 3. 信息在网络中传输。 4. 接收方使用私钥解密信息。这种机制不仅确保了信息的保密性,也确保了信息的完整性和身份认证,确保交易的参与者真实而可信。
### 非对称加密在加密货币中的应用 #### 地址生成与私钥管理在加密货币中,每个用户都有一个数字钱包,每个钱包由一个地址(公钥)和一个私钥组成。用户可以将公钥分享给别人,用于接收资金,但私钥则只应由用户自己保管。私钥的安全性直接关系到用户资产的安全。
当用户创建一个新的加密货币钱包时,系统会自动生成一对密钥。用户需要记录下私钥,并妥善保管。遗失私钥将导致无法再访问相应地址上的资金,因此,私钥的管理是用户需要特别关心的问题。
#### 交易签名与验证当用户发起交易时,必须用自己的私钥对交易进行签名。这一过程不仅保护了用户身份的真实性,也防止了交易信息的篡改。网络中的节点利用相应的公钥验证签名的有效性,确保交易的合法性。
例如,用户A向用户B发送加密货币。A用私钥生成一个交易签名,然后将交易信息及该签名一起发送给网络。网络节点使用A的公钥验证签名,确保只有A用户才能发起这一交易。这样一来,即使其他人获取了交易信息,他们也无法伪造签名,因为没有A的私钥。
### 非对称加密带来的安全性提升 #### 防止伪造交易非对称加密的引入,使得伪造交易几乎不可能。由于交易的签名是基于私钥生成的,任何没有私钥的人都无法创建有效的签名,从而无法发起交易。这为加密货币网络建立了安全屏障,保障了用户资产的安全。
同时,在区块链中,每个区块包含了前一区块的哈希值,这样不仅增强了数据的完整性,也进一步防止了伪造行为。一旦某一区块被篡改,后续所有区块的哈希值都将不再匹配,导致整条链失效。
#### 保护用户隐私非对称加密还为用户提供了一定的匿名性。虽然所有交易记录在区块链上公开可见,但由于用户身份与公钥之间没有直接的关联,用户可以在一定程度上保护个人隐私。这种特性是许多人选择使用加密货币的重要原因之一。
特别是在进行大额交易或者敏感交易时,用户更加希望保持匿名,非对称加密的特性恰好能满足这一需求。
### 非对称加密的挑战与解决方案 #### 对于私钥安全的威胁尽管非对称加密为加密货币提供了安全性的提升,但私钥的安全性始终是一个问题。如果用户的私钥被盗,黑客将能够完全控制他的资产。
为了应对这一挑战,用户可以采取多种措施,如冷钱包存储(将私钥离线存储),使用硬件钱包,或者启用多重签名交易(需要多个私钥进行确认)来增强安全性。
#### 未来的发展方向随着技术的不断进步,非对称加密也在不断演化。量子计算的出现可能会对传统的非对称加密算法造成威胁。为此,加密货币领域正在探索量子抗性算法,以确保未来的安全性。
### 未来非对称加密在区块链中的潜力 #### 跨链交易与互操作性随着区块链技术的发展,跨链交易的需求越来越强烈。非对称加密在跨链交易中的应用可以确保交易的安全性与可信度,促进各个区块链之间的合作与信息交换。
通过公私钥机制,可以创建跨链智能合约,确保不同链之间的资产安全转移。这为金融体系的进一步去中心化提供了可能性。
#### 去中心化金融(DeFi)中的作用去中心化金融正迅速崛起,非对称加密是其基础安全设施。DeFi应用广泛使用公私钥机制来确保用户资产的安全性,使得用户能够在没有中心化机构的情况下自由交易和借贷。
非对称加密还可以帮助实现身份验证和信贷评级,使DeFi更加高效和安全。这将为下一代金融系统的建设奠定基础。
### 结论非对称加密技术在加密货币中的应用,不仅提升了交易的安全性,还保护了用户隐私,防止了伪造行为的发生。尽管面临一些挑战,这项技术仍将继续发展,未来在区块链及其相关应用领域中的潜力无限。
通过不断创新与完善非对称加密技术,我们将能够构建一个更加安全、可靠的数字经济体系。
## 相关问题 1. 非对称加密与对称加密的本质区别是什么? 2. 如何安全地管理加密货币中的私钥? 3. 非对称加密在区块链中是如何实现的? 4. 加密货币中的交易签名是如何生成和验证的? 5. 非对称加密未来可能面临哪些挑战? 6. 去中心化金融(DeFi)中非对称加密的作用是什么? ### 非对称加密与对称加密的本质区别是什么?对称加密和非对称加密是两大基础加密技术。对称加密的本质是双方共同使用同一个密钥,这种方式虽然相对简单,但也带来了一定的风险,例如密钥的安全传输、管理和存储问题。一旦密钥被截获,所有使用该密钥加密的信息都有可能被解密。
非对称加密则使用一对密钥(公钥和私钥)。公钥可以广泛分发,而私钥则需妥善保管,只有拥有私钥的人才能解密用公钥加密的信息。这种设计使得非对称加密在保障信息安全的同时,提供了更强的身份验证能力。
总结来说,对称加密适合于多方快速共享数据的场景,而非对称加密则在身份确认和安全传输方面表现出更加优越的特性。在加密货币的应用中,非对称加密起到了至关重要的作用。
### 如何安全地管理加密货币中的私钥?私钥的安全性直接关系到加密货币的安全,因此管理私钥尤为重要。首先,用户应避免将私钥在线存储,避免使用带有安全隐患的设备。建议使用冷钱包存储私钥,例如硬件钱包,这样可以在没有网络的环境下保持私钥的安全。
其次,用户可以启用多重签名(Multisig)功能,要求多个私钥共同签名才能执行交易。此外,备份私钥也是十分必要的,用户应确保保存私钥的地方不易被其他人发现,例如写在纸上存放在安全的地方或使用密码管理软件进行加密存储。
最后,用户还应定期检查自己的加密资产及交易记录,以确保没有异常活动。一旦发现问题,应立即采取相应措施。
### 非对称加密在区块链中是如何实现的?非对称加密在区块链中的实现主要依赖于公私钥机制。当用户创建区块链钱包时,系统为他们生成一对密钥:公钥和私钥。用户可以将公钥分享给他人,以接收加密货币;而私钥则需妥善保管,用于控制用户资产以及签署交易。
在交易过程中,用户先生成交易信息,然后用私钥对该交易进行签名。签名的过程是通过非对称加密算法完成的,这确保了交易的完整性和身份认证。网络中的节点会使用相应的公钥对签名进行验证,确保交易的合法性。
区块链的本质是去中心化的分布式账本技术,使用非对称加密可以确保各个参与者在进行交易时,身份真实而可信,从而提高了网络的安全性和用户信任度。
### 加密货币中的交易签名是如何生成和验证的?在加密货币中,交易签名的生成和验证是确保交易安全和合法的重要步骤。当用户准备发起交易时,他们会使用自己的私钥对交易信息进行签名。具体来说,这一过程如下:
1. 用户创建交易,包括发送方、接收方和交易金额等信息。 2. 系统将交易信息进行哈希处理,生成唯一的哈希值。 3. 用户用私钥对哈希值进行加密,生成交易签名。当交易被发送到网络中时,其他节点会使用发送方的公钥来验证签名。验证过程如下:
1. 节点接收到交易信息及其签名。 2. 节点用发送方的公钥解密签名,得到解密后的哈希值。 3. 节点对交易信息重新进行哈希,得到新的哈希值。 4. 将新哈希值与解密后的哈希值进行比对。如果两者相同,说明签名有效,交易合法。这一过程的安全性依赖于非对称加密算法的强度,即便交易信息被篡改,签名的有效性也会受到影响,从而无法得到合法确认。
### 非对称加密未来可能面临哪些挑战?非对称加密技术在加密货币中的应用固然强大,但未来可能面临一些挑战。首先,随着量子计算技术的发展,现有非对称加密算法如RSA可能会受到威胁。量子计算可以利用量子位进行超快的计算,这使得传统的加密算法变得脆弱。
第二,私钥的管理仍旧是一个重要问题。如果用户未能妥善保管私钥,可能会导致资产的永久丢失。此外,黑客攻击、病毒传播等因素也可能影响私钥的安全性。
还有,随着区块链技术的不断演进,可能会出现新的攻击方式。因此,需要不断研发和完善非对称加密算法,以增强其安全性。
### 去中心化金融(DeFi)中非对称加密的作用是什么?去中心化金融(DeFi)是一个新兴领域,致力于通过区块链为用户提供免去中心化机构的金融服务。非对称加密在此中的作用至关重要。首先,非对称加密确保了用户身份验证的安全性。在DeFi中,用户通过其公私钥进行身份确认,确保了交易参与者的真实可靠。
其次,非对称加密为DeFi中的资产转移提供了安全保障。用户在进行借贷、交易等操作时,都需要用其私钥对交易进行签名,确保交易的合法性与完整性。
不仅如此,非对称加密也使得DeFi平台的智能合约能够安全执行。 contracts通过非对称加密保障了交易执行的透明性和不可篡改性。此外,非对称加密还可以与去中心化身份(DID)结合,为用户提供更好的隐私保护和控制权,进一步增强DeFi系统的安全性和用户体验。
--- 以上是围绕非对称加密货币的主题详细展开的内容和问题解答,您可以根据需要进一步细化与扩展每部分的点。